WHETHER YOU ARE DRIVING FORWARD OR IN REVERSE
n Pull on the left handgrip to steer your Laser to the left.
n Pull on the right handgrip to steer your Laser to the right.
n Move the tiller to the center position to drive straight ahead.
n Release the throttle control lever to decelerate and come to a complete stop.
n The electric brake automatically engages when your Laser comes to a stop.
NOTE: The rear-wheel drive transaxle gives your Laser maximum traction with minimal steering effort on
your part.
GETTING OFF OF YOUR LASER
1. Bring your Laser to a complete stop.
2. Make certain that the key is turned (counterclockwise) to the off position.
3. Push down on the seat rotation lever and rotate the seat until you are facing toward the side of your Laser.
4. Make certain that the seat is locked securely in position.
5. Unfasten the lap belt, if equipped.
6. Carefully and safely get out of the seat and stand to the side of your Laser.
7. You may, if you wish, leave the seat facing to the side to facilitate boarding your Laser the next time you are
going to operate it.
AUTO SHUTOFF FEATURE
The Laser is equipped with an energy saving auto shutoff feature.
n If the Laser key switch is left in the on position and the Sport Scooter remains inactive for approximately 20
minutes, the motor controller will automatically shut down. This feature is designed to preserve battery life.
NOTE: Although the motor controller will be shut down by the auto shutoff feature, all activated lights will
remain on. For maximum battery life it is recommended that you turn off your lights or turn the key to the
off position.
To restore power back to the Laser:
n Turn the key counterclockwise to the off position.
n Turn the key clockwise to the on position.
Your Laser will now resume normal operation.
